A personal accident insurance is a health policy that covers the cost of treatment due to an accident. These plans cover the life assured and offer a payout to cover expenses like ambulance costs, emergency surgery expenses, doctor’s consultation, and more.
Why do you need personal accident insurance?
Accidents can happen at any time without prior notice, and occasionally they can have significant consequences.
Any such unfortunate event can have a big effect on your money since not only can the treatment be expensive, but it can also reduce your earning potential if you have any kind of impairment.
When an accident results in death, physical harm, temporary entire disability, permanent total disability, or permanent partial disability, personal accident insurance can help you and your family gain financial support.
The insurance provider will provide the designated nominee with 100% of the sum guaranteed in the case of death.
Additionally, insurance companies provide benefits for disabilities resulting from accidents, such as loss of eyesight, speech, or limbs.

TYPES OF PERSONAL ACCIDENT INSURANCE
Group Personal Accident Insurance
Employers and business owners typically purchase group personal accident insurance to protect their workforce. The insurance companies give a reduction on the rate based on the size of the business and the number of employees. A group personal accident coverage is a great way to motivate your staff since it ensures their financial security in the case of an accident at work.
2. Individual Personal Accident Insurance
As its name implies, it is acquired by an individual, and it protects the policyholders from unintentional harm. It typically includes unintentional death, body part loss, and other disability brought on by an accident.

ACCIDENTAL DEATH
Ensures your family's financial well-being by paying the chosen sum insured amount, post the unfortunate event of your death due to accident or injury.
PERMANENT TOTAL & PARTIAL DISABILITY
Disability can ruin anyone's financial stability. It offers up to 100% sum insured in case of permanent or partial loss of pre-specified body organs.
RECONSTRUCTIVE SURGERY
If a medical condition has malformed your bodily functions, you can get reimbursement for reconstructive surgery that is performed as per policy terms.
FRACTURES
Recovering from a fracture is an expensive journey. It lowers your burden by reimbursing up to 100% of SI in case of fractures, as listed in the policy.
CHILD EDUCATION
Offers the best accidental insurance plan that takes care of your dependent children's education in the unfortunate event of accidental death or disability.
MAJOR DIAGNOSTICS
Supports you in bearing the expenses of major diagnostic tests like CT scans, MRIS, etc., as prescribed by a medical practitioner and conducted as per policy terms.
SEVERE BURNS
Supports you during an unfortunate event of second and third-degree burns across the body surface by paying you up to the sum insured as per policy terms.

Q. What advantages are provided by this policy?
A. With personal accident insurance, you can now safeguard your complete family against unintentional injuries. You and your family are covered by the insurance in the event of accidental death, permanent disability, broken bones, or burns. The expense of the ambulance and the money for the hospital are also benefits.
Q. How many individuals can be covered by the family plan?
A. Under the Family Plan, your spouse and two dependent children are also covered.
Q. Can I include my parents in this policy?
A. Yes, up to 70 years, you can include your dependent parents. Parents who are dependent on you can receive additional benefits from personal accident insurance at a low fixed cost. Now you have the opportunity to repay some of the affection and care they showed you.

Q. What does the term "dependent child" mean?
A. Dependent children are those who live with the insured individual and are not married, and who are under the age of 21 if they are enrolled in full-time school or between the ages of 3 months and 18 years.
Q. Does the age requirement apply when choosing personal accident insurance?
A. Personal Accident Insurance is open to everyone from the age of 18 years to 65 years.
